ctf: Add unittests for the CTF Lexer and Parser.
This is a first draft of unittests for the CTF Lexer and Parser.
The coverage of these tests is still incomplete. More unittests
are to come.
Some tests are commented and need to fix the grammars.
The plan is to fix them in future commits to limits the
amount of refactoring.
Change-Id: I2d8e06560314ef22710985915b726a74974bbb1c
Signed-off-by: Etienne Bergeron <etienne.bergeron@gmail.com>
Reviewed-on: https://git.eclipse.org/r/19485
Tested-by: Hudson CI
Reviewed-by: Alexandre Montplaisir <alexmonthy@voxpopuli.im>
IP-Clean: Alexandre Montplaisir <alexmonthy@voxpopuli.im>
Reviewed-by: Matthew Khouzam <matthew.khouzam@ericsson.com>